Today we went on one of the most amazing coastal railway journeys. If you are willing to put up with a little discomfort you can get some really amazing views from the city all the way down the coast to Simon's Town.
The train was falling apart and I know that people can be worried about security in this region. Having said this, if you want to go down to Boulders beach and you can stomach a little discomfort then it's well worth it.
The main reason people visit Simon's Town? The penguins!
The penguins were right next to us nesting on and around this beach, and in fact they are here all year round. It’s quite strange to see them in summer waddling about. These are the same penguins you'd see in Antartica.
The penguins were wild, but not at all fussed by us taking pictures. These penguins on Boulder beach are a huge tourist attraction to the area.
